Myers wrote the comedy film that is centred around a 40-year-old Stanley Cup drought (man, is this far fetched) by the Leafs. Myers plays a self-help expert who is challenged to settle a rift between a star on the Leafs (Romany Malco) and his estranged wife. After the split, the wife begins dating Los Angeles Kings star Jacques Grande (Justin Timberlake) out of revenge. This sends her husband into a professional skid, to the horror of Leafs team owner (Jessica Alba) and coach (Verne Troyer). Yes, Troyer is the Mini-Me character of Austin Powers fame. A release is planned for June 20, 2008.
